arquillian-core icon indicating copy to clipboard operation
arquillian-core copied to clipboard

ARQ-2235 arquillian-bom should not include Maven artifacts not produced by this project

Open rhusar opened this issue 1 year ago • 2 comments

Namely the shrinkwrap project. This is a separate bom produced by separate projects. This otherwise causes dependency ordering headaches for consumers that import this pom into their dependencyManagement section, especially since the currently provided version lags behind upstream releases.

https://issues.redhat.com/browse/ARQ-2235

rhusar avatar Jul 01 '24 20:07 rhusar

Marked as draft just to have a consensus before we go ahead. This makes the bom be compliant with maven definition - see https://maven.apache.org/guides/introduction/introduction-to-dependency-mechanism.html#bill-of-materials-bom-poms

rhusar avatar Jul 01 '24 20:07 rhusar

Yes, let's go forward with this and I'll do a 1.9.0.Final release

starksm64 avatar Jul 04 '24 02:07 starksm64